Driving a car when you are tired

Research from think.direct.gov.uk suggests that:

• Almost 20% of accidents on major roads are sleep-related
• Sleep-related accidents are more likely than others to result in a fatality or serious injury
• Peak times for accidents are in the early hours and after lunch
• About 40% of sleep-related accidents involve commercial vehicles
• Men under 30 have the highest risk of falling asleep at the wheel

It really couldn’t be more plain. Drowsiness and sleep deprivation can slow your reaction time to that of someone driving while drunk. If you are tired when you drive your chances of causing an accident when you’ve not had enough sleep increase dramatically.
